←Select platform

LeadCollection<T> Class

Summary

Represents a dynamic data collection that provides notifications when items get added, removed, or when the whole list is refreshed.

Syntax

C#
VB
C++
[DefaultMemberAttribute("Item")] 
public class LeadCollection<T> : Collection<T> 
Public Class LeadCollection(Of T)  
   Inherits System.Collections.ObjectModel.Collection(Of T) 
   Implements System.Collections.Generic.ICollection(Of T), System.Collections.Generic.IEnumerable(Of T), System.Collections.Generic.IList(Of T), System.Collections.Generic.IReadOnlyCollection(Of T), System.Collections.Generic.IReadOnlyList(Of T), System.Collections.ICollection, System.Collections.IEnumerable, System.Collections.IList  
generic<typename T> 
public ref class LeadCollection : public System.Collections.ObjectModel.Collection<T>, System.Collections.Generic.ICollection<T>, System.Collections.Generic.IEnumerable<T>, System.Collections.Generic.IList<T>, System.Collections.Generic.IReadOnlyCollection<T>, System.Collections.Generic.IReadOnlyList<T>, System.Collections.ICollection, System.Collections.IEnumerable, System.Collections.IList   

Type Parameters

T
A generic Type parameter.

Remarks
The LeadCollection<T> class provides a generic observable collection class that overrides the .NET Collection<T>, class.

The class contains the CollectionChanged event. This events will fire whenever objects are added, moved, replaced or removed to/from the collection.

This class follows the design of the .NET ObservableCollection<T> class.
Requirements

Target Platforms

Help Version 19.0.2017.10.27
Products | Support | Contact Us | Copyright Notices
© 1991-2017 LEAD Technologies, Inc. All Rights Reserved.

Leadtools Assembly